Welcome Picture of Captain Crozier Monument
Banbridge, Down
Bannbridge town's most famous son was probably Captain Crozier of North West Passage fame who was born in 1796 at a large house in the town's Church Square. Crozier lead many exploratory trips to the North and South Pole.
Today the house looks out onto the Crozier Monument which has a unique feature at its base - four polar bears who look up at a statue of Captain Crozier whose gaze is to the North West....
